The Military Court executes three Al-Shabaab militants in Mogadishu

Mogadishu(SONNA)-The Court of the Armed Forces on Wednesday executed three Al-Shabaab militants by firing squad here in Mogadishu after finding them guilty of being member of the terrorist group and committed several criminal cases including deadly attacks, SONNA reported.

Mohamed Abdulle Abkow, Sharif Mohamed Barqadle and Mohamed Abdi Nur appeared from the court sessions several times during their trial, and they finally admitted guilt of masterminding terrorist attacks, and killings in Mogadishu during the past decade.

The Director of Public Relations of the Armed Forces Judiciary Court, Abdulkadir Isse told Somali National News Agency that two of these terrorists claimed to have fake army ranks, professions and titles like doctor for a cover up tactics, in. order to hide their dangerous purposes, saying these were involved in deadly attacks at Aden Abdulle Airport and suicide car bomb attacks at hotels in the parts before the security forces arrested them.

The execution comes as the Somali Government’s total war on Al-Shabaab militants intensified in recent months.
